I was thinking this morning on my way to Khayelitsha, “in God’s kingdom, who would receive the most respect? What type of person would be the most popular? Most mighty? Who would God honor?” Immediately I had a very simple answer. People who clean after others… those who do the work people hate to do, things that the lowliest have to do…

people who excel in school! People with tons of money! The successful! People with power! Smart people! No matter how much I think about it, I know that it’s not these… not that they are bad just because of what they have. If they boast and look down on others with their positions and possessions, what they have gained will just cause them harm in the end. One thing is for sure: as a citizen of God’s kingdom, if one can joyfully do anything that others hate to do, God will honor them. Someone that can truly serve others, one that is selfless… even though one is able to gain and possess much, to give it all up to humbly serve… God will undoubtedly honor them. The mighty in heaven… one who is humble and has a servant heart. One who sacrifices and gives, and is modest – this is experiencing the Kingdom, this is the life of the Kingdom.

Father! Make me one who only looks to the Kingdom beyond this world. Make me one that you would honor in your Kingdom, a person of your Kingdom. I want to be made of humility and servanthood. Grant me the joy of surrender and sacrifice so that I may reside in the Kingdom.
